
A 回答 (4件)
- 最新から表示
- 回答順に表示

No.4
- 回答日時:
> E2の所定時間は出勤より22:00までの勤務時間-休憩時間(22:00以前に取った場合のみ)
> という計算がほしかったです。
> なので、この場合所定時間が12時間となります。
. A B C D E F
1| 出勤時刻 退勤時刻 外出時刻 戻り時刻 所定時間 超過時間
2| 9:00 23:00 21:00 23:00 12:00 5:00
E2セルを、
=IF(B2<=TIME(22,0,0),B2-A2,TIME(22,0,0)-A2)-(IF(C2>=TIME(22,0,0),0,IF(D2<=TIME(22,0,0),(D2-C2+IF(C2>D2,1)),TIME(22,0,0)-C2)))
とします。
【訂正】
F2セルを、
=IF((B2-A2+IF(A2>=B2,1))-(IF(C2>=TIME(22,0,0),0,IF(D2<=TIME(22,0,0),(D2-C2+IF(C2>D2,1)),TIME(22,0,0)-C2)))>TIME(8,0,0),((B2-A2+IF(A2>=B2,1))-(IF(C2>=TIME(22,0,0),0,IF(D2<=TIME(22,0,0),(D2-C2+IF(C2>D2,1)),TIME(22,0,0)-C2))))-TIME(8,0,0),"-")
とします。
※外出せずに、外出時刻、戻り時刻が空白の場合でも対応しています。


No.3
- 回答日時:
> もし、22:00以前に休憩をとった場合のみ
> 計算をするというやり方はありますでしょうか。
> (22時以降の休憩は計算しない)
条件が以下であれば、
1.22:00以降の休憩を休憩時間にカウントしない
2.22:00以降の休憩を勤務時間にカウントする
. A B C D E F
1| 出勤時刻 退勤時刻 外出時刻 戻り時刻 所定時間 超過時間
2| 9:00 23:00 21:00 23:00 3.45 5:00
F2セルを、
=IF((B2-A2+IF(A2>=B2,1))-(D2-C2+IF(C2>=D2,1))>TIME(8,0,0),((B2-A2+IF(A2>=B2,1))-IF(C2>=TIME(22,0,0),0,IF(D2<=TIME(22,0,0),(D2-C2+IF(C2>=D2,1)),TIME(22,0,0)-C2)))-TIME(8,0,0),"-")
とすればよいでしょう。

本当にありがとうございます。
ですが、すみません、自分の質問が悪いことに気が付きました。
E2の所定時間は出勤より22:00までの勤務時間ー休憩時間(22:00以前に取った場合のみ)
という計算がほしかったです。
なので、この場合所定時間が12時間となります。

No.2
- 回答日時:
№1です。
エラーメッセージは何でしょう?
入力せずにコピー&ペーストしてみてはいかがでしょう。
たぶん、自分で質問したものの、回答をいただいても
活用できていないんだと思います。。。
もう少し、かみ砕いた質問をさせていただいてもよろしいでしょうか。
(コピー&ペーストもしてみます)
例えば
出勤 退勤 外出 戻り
20:00 25:00 21:00 22:00
勤務時間を計算
退勤ー出勤ー休憩(戻り―外出)
ですが、休憩に条件を付けて、もし、22:00以前に休憩をとった場合のみ
計算をするというやり方はありますでしょうか。
(22時以降の休憩は計算しない)
すみません、よろしくおねがいします。

No.1
- 回答日時:
1案
(1).F2セルに、
=IF((B2-A2+IF(A2>=B2,1))-(D2-C2+IF(C2>=D2,1))>TIME(8,0,0),((B2-A2+IF(A2>=B2,1))-(D2-C2+IF(C2>=D2,1)))-TIME(8,0,0),"-")
と入力します。
(2).F2セルの書式設定を[表示設定][分類][時刻]、[配置][文字の配置][横位置][右詰め]にします。

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Excel(エクセル) エクセル2019の関数を教えてください。 8 2022/12/16 12:45
- Excel(エクセル) エクセルで勤務時間の計算をしています。 下記図でstartは勤務開始時間、endは勤務終了時間です。 5 2022/06/07 13:51
- 就職 ホワイト企業ですか? 3 2023/03/10 15:16
- その他(Microsoft Office) 勤務表のエクセル作成で数式を教えてください。 1 2023/01/17 03:27
- 労働相談 労働時間が五、六時間 その弐 2 2023/04/04 12:36
- Excel(エクセル) 出退勤管理の遅刻・早退時間について 3 2023/08/10 15:33
- その他(ビジネススキル・経営ノウハウ) 今まで午後勤務しかやったことありません。 8時から17時で9時間休憩入れて8時間勤務に変わります。お 1 2023/02/07 21:50
- Excel(エクセル) 指定した値以上の中で最小値を出したい 7 2022/10/24 21:12
- 会社・職場 私のバイト先は勤怠が15分刻みでカウントされます。 例えば9時50分に打刻したら10時00分扱いにな 6 2023/04/09 14:04
- 会社・職場 勤務時間及び時間外労働について 2 2022/06/20 18:15
このQ&Aを見た人はこんなQ&Aも見ています
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
スマートウォッチに時刻の合わ...
-
深夜残業時間を求めたいのです。
-
午後11時59分って何時? 昼の11...
-
京都に223系を入れたのは、221...
-
SL(DL)やまぐち号 津和野行きの...
-
VBA で PCの 時刻を サーバー時...
-
現在の時間を5分単位で切り捨...
-
便宜機票
-
時刻は毎月変わる?
-
東北新幹線はやて351号の東京駅...
-
8時間以上だったら1時間マイ...
-
エクセル 時間計算 指定の時...
-
OUTLOOK365 時間を変えたいです。
-
標準時間と117の時間の10秒のずれ
-
至急お願いします。 現在東海道...
-
電車の空調が効きすぎると高齢...
-
この画像を見ると東京駅から池...
-
全車指定席の列車に指定席を買...
-
特急や新幹線の領収書から 乗っ...
-
東海道新幹線 のぞみの指定席料...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
Accessの重複なしのカウントの...
-
午後11時59分って何時? 昼の11...
-
[MS Access]クエリで変換 hhmm...
-
8時間以上だったら1時間マイ...
-
電線等の入線潤滑材の代用品っ...
-
iPhoneのボイスメモ
-
SL(DL)やまぐち号 津和野行きの...
-
標準時間と117の時間の10秒のずれ
-
VBA で PCの 時刻を サーバー時...
-
[h]:mm形式→10進法への変換
-
Excelで90分後を自動計算
-
京都に223系を入れたのは、221...
-
Excelでミリsecまでの2つの時...
-
フリー wifi でwindowsの時刻が...
-
エクセルでの経過日数と時間の...
-
時刻と時間を明確に区別したい...
-
英語のメール 題名
-
ポルトガル語で何といいますか...
-
時間計算 エラー表示を無くしたい
-
時間帯別作業時間についてエク...
おすすめ情報